What is bugging us is the system tablespace is asking for a redo from two weeks ago, when reviewing the logs from recent hot backups no errors are reported for the system table space.

We have created another control file from the existing db and tried a recover. It still asks for the old redo.

Is there a way to accept the inconsistent state, force the database open, so we might export the data?
